OpenAI's For-Profit Transition: A Controversial Shift Sparks Debate
OpenAI's decision to move towards a for‑profit model has stirred significant debate among ex‑employees, AI experts, and the public. With concerns ranging from conflicts of interest to decreased transparency, the restructuring raises critical questions about the future of AI development and its societal impact. Anthropic Secures SpaceX's Colossus for AI Compute Boost
Anthropic partners with SpaceX to secure 300 megawatts at the Colossus One data center, utilizing over 220,000 Nvidia GPUs. This collaboration addresses the demand surge for Anthropic's Claude Code service and marks a strategic expansion in AI compute resources.
